Her PhD research at the University of Leeds looked much further back in time. Using a range of isotope and organic geochemical proxies in combination with an isotope-enabled General Circulation Model, she reconstructed past vegetation, continental temperature and hydrological cycling on Antarctica, 3 – 14 million years ago, during a period of large-scale Antarctic Ice Sheet retreat. This work provided important insights into high Southern latitude climate change, in particular suggesting a marked reorganisation of the hydrological cycle over the continent driven by ice sheet collapse.
